There was an increased proportion of in-season ACL tears in the 2020 NFL season relative to 2014 to 2019; this is attributable to a frameshift in the consistent trend of injuries in the 1st month to return of competitive play, with 2020 being in the regular season in September as opposed to the preseason in August. The average return to play timeline according to the vast majority of research is about 9-12 months, but the tricky thing is that return to play does not always equal return to performance. I often go on other podcasts or get asked questions with a lot of people assuming something along the lines of ACL injuries arent that big of a deal anymore or Players are recovering way faster than they used to, so ACLs arent as bad as they used to be. While theressome merit to this that the best athletes in the world are recovering better than they were a decade ago, is the general public right in assuming that ACL injuries arent as big of a deal as they used to be? In the absence of preseason games, more full-contact practices took place in 2020 than in 2019, meaning that the rate of concussion in preseason practice went down in 2020. But, as it stands right now, the data shows that RBs coming off an ACL surgery tend to be less efficient and have worse fantasy seasons in their first year following surgery when compared to their pre-injury career averagesand when compared to year two after surgery.
